Output 89c3d220bf9d47a74be8ebe0e64d28d7e5dbedd3ac93d69aaa5b2dff54b1c530:1

value
2506220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ac8cc2c02d5941729bb80dd38de76cf572ff19 OP_EQUAL
address
39EA3FJRUrxks1yBKkox1pu9Wimu8dy5Tb
transaction
89c3d220bf9d47a74be8ebe0e64d28d7e5dbedd3ac93d69aaa5b2dff54b1c530
spent
true